vimarsana.com
Home
Oil Lube Filter Service In Hubbard
Top Locations Tagged with Oil Lube Filter Service In Hubbard
Oil Lube Filter Service In Hubbard in United States - 56470/Automotive-service near Hubbard
1). Premier Lube & Repair
2). West Side Auto
vimarsana © 2020. All Rights Reserved.